Ticket: Night-shift access — Support team, Halverton Depot. Raised by the duty supervisor at Nocturne Systems. The support team now covers the 22:00–06:00 rotation and needs entry via the rear stairwell, as the main lobby is locked after 21:00. Facilities have confirmed the rear door reader is active for all rostered night staff from Monday. Cleaners retain separate access and should not be asked to let anyone in. Until individual badges are issued, use the shared night code below.

staff pass of kawip-hawef = bdg-QLP-2

SquatSentry scans registry uploads for typo-squatting package names. Three environments: dev, staging, prod.

Dev runs against a mirrored registry snapshot, refreshed nightly. Staging consumes the live feed but only logs matches. Prod blocks and quarantines. Levenshtein thresholds differ per environment — dev is intentionally noisy for tuning.

As discussed last sync, the edit-distance model was swapped for the bigram scorer in staging; prod follows next week pending Marit's sign-off.

Current prod configuration is as follows.

service settings:
[silwyn]
host = silwyn.crelvogrid.internal
user = silwyn_svc
database = silwyn_prod

Turnstile counters at Harrowfield Arena aggregate per-gate ticks into 5s buckets. Peak ingress is bounded by gate hardware, not the service, so we size buffers for worst-case simultaneous scans across all 48 gates plus 20% headroom. Backpressure drops to a local spool, never the counter. Constants under review:

tuning table, faduf-baduf:
PRIORITIES = {
    "ulavan": 191,
    "silys": 750,
    "goriel": 238,
    "kelmir": 66,
    "wendor": 432,
}

## Action Item: Cron Drift Follow-up

The nightly reconciliation job on the Lanternworks batch cluster drifted 43 minutes over two weeks because workers synced time against a deprecated internal source. We will migrate all schedulers to the shared timing service and add a drift alarm at the five-minute mark. New team members: note that cron hosts must never set time locally — always defer to the timing service. Full migration steps and the rollout calendar are documented on the internal page below.

dashboard of tahaf-fadug = https://grafana.qorvelcorp.internal/browse/browse/job/557b2263e0b5